PCCA’s Virtual Academy is a series of video courses available for rent to schools and community organizations. Rostered teaching artists with PCCA’s Arts in Education residency program, a partnership with the Pennsylvania Council on the Arts, have created instructional videos – with accompanying lesson plans and resource materials – designed to explore the core elements of their artistic disciplines.

HOW IT WORKS

Sites may solely book the virtual course (hosted on Google Classroom) consisting of three to five video lessons and access to supplemental materials, or expand the opportunity into an artist residency with additional virtual or in-person instructional days. The Virtual Academy provides access to arts education programming for PCCA’S service area and gives our teaching artists an opportunity to engage students in new ways. Courses will be rented for an access period of 90 days. Please see the below list of the exciting options we have available!

PRE-K/ELEMENTARY

Chinese Dragon with Hua Hua Zhang

Grades: Pre-K, Kindergarten, 1, 2, 3

Learn about the friendly Chinese Dragon in this fun visual arts class with Hua Hua Zhang! Throughout the course, students will be guided through the creation of a paper collage and a dragon shadow puppet. Hua Hua will show you around her beautiful art studio and demonstrate the art of Chinese Puppet Theater.

Creative Storytelling with Rachita Nambiar

Grades: Pre-K, Kindergarten

Rachita Nambiar introduces children to the land of India and storytelling. This course targets physical and emotional development in young students through fun use of hand gestures and facial expressions, used to tell stories and make objects/animals. The dance videos can also be used as a great exercise tool to engage children in a classroom setting.

ELEMENTARY/MIDDLE SCHOOL

Superpower Art Quilt with Janice Bailor

Grades: 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8

Textile artist Janice Bailor guides students through the creation of their own Superpower Art Quilt in this exciting, five-lesson course! Join her in multi-part lessons which include artist vocabulary, techniques, project creation, and even a stop motion video to increase understanding of self-expression through the textile arts. Schools and sites can choose to add or incorporate live virtual sessions with the artist for an additional fee.

Stop Motion Animation with Rand Whipple of Box of Light Studios

Grades: 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9

Join Box of Light’s Rand Whipple in creating a stop motion animation from start to finish. Rand guides students through the setup, shooting, and editing processes with the use of accessible tools and apps. This course includes teacher videos, app tutorials, and bonus content for students eager to dive into the digital arts.

MIDDLE/HIGH SCHOOL

Performance Confidence with Bloomsburg Theatre Ensemble

Grades: 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12

Bloomsburg Theatre Ensemble’s Abby Leffler guides students through the basics of confidence on the stage. Students will learn how to apply character and projection, as well as various warmup exercises in this three-lesson course. This course includes bonus content specifically tailored for middle and high school students!
